This Device uses founded basal metabolic charge (BMR) formulation combined with an exercise multiplier to provide specific estimates. BMR signifies the calories Your whole body wants at rest to keep up very important capabilities like respiratory, circulation, and mobile generation. By calculating TDEE, you obtain Perception into the full energy burned daily, which includes training and everyday movement, making it much easier to craft sustainable meal plans.The TDEE Calculator stands out for its versatility, providing a few reputable BMR formulas customized to distinctive people. The Mifflin–St Jeor equation is usually recommended for the majority of Grown ups due to its precision throughout a wide range of entire body sorts; it things in age, Organic sex, peak, and fat for a practical baseline. The Harris–Benedict method, a revised traditional, provides a strong alternative with roots in early 20th-century investigate, updated to raised account for contemporary existence. For individuals who track physique composition intently, the Katch–McArdle formulation shines—it necessitates entire body fat proportion and focuses on lean mass, which makes it perfect for athletes or any one with precise measurements. These choices make sure the calculator adapts on your exclusive profile, boosting its reliability.

Interpreting TDEE Calculator outcomes demands a realistic frame of mind. Your output may well display a TDEE of two,500 calories for maintenance, For illustration. For weight-loss, aim for a safe calorie deficit of ten–fifteen% beneath TDEE, equating to 250-375 much less energy day-to-day, which usually yields 0.5-1 kg reduction per week devoid of crashing your metabolism. Muscle mass obtain requires a modest surplus of around 5–10%, incorporating a hundred twenty five-250 calories to prioritize development when reducing fat obtain. These are not set-in-stone regulations—keep track of your excess weight and human body composition around two–four months. If progress stalls, alter by one hundred-200 calories and reassess. Specific metabolism differs wildly; variables like rest excellent, Serious worry, hormonal fluctuations, and training depth can change your true TDEE by many calories.
